The Air-In® noise reducer effectively reduces noise from machines and ducts as well as noise between flats. It allows a maximum inflow of air of 250 litres per second with efficient noise reduction.
The Air-In® noise trap achieves better results using a single damper than most other products using two.


| Product | Height, mm | Width, mm | Length, mm | Installation duct Ø, mm |
| Air-In 125 Super | 200 | 250 | 450 | 125* |
| Air-In 160 Super | 200 | 400 | 600 | 160** |
| Air-In 200 Super | 300 | 400 | 600 | 200*** |
|
* can be changed to Ø 100 mm using a conversion connection ** can be changed to Ø 125/100 mm using a conversion connection *** can be changed to Ø 160 mm using a conversion connection |

The Air-In® 125 Super is a new generation silencer designed according to the increased requirements of house noise reduction.

Air-In® 125 Super is better than its predecessor in almost all octave bands. The amount of air can be adjusted steplessly and without noise. The silencer is therefore very well suited for use as a damper/attenuator when lots of branches are taken from the main air duct. The silencer also includes measurement connections for the measurement of the amount of air as well as a large cleaning hatch for cleaning the ducts. Compact size is one of the important features of Air-In 125 Super.
